Partial Cash Settlement Valuation Date definition

Partial Cash Settlement Valuation Date means, in respect of an Undeliverable Obligation, the fifth Business Day following the Last Permissible Physical Settlement Date (provided that, in the case of a Partial Cash Settlement Trigger Event under paragraph (iii) of the definition thereof, the Partial Cash Settlement Valuation Date shall be any date selected by the Calculation Agent in its sole discretion).
Partial Cash Settlement Valuation Date means, subject as provided in paragraphs (e) and (f) of “Credit Events”, the fifth Payment Business Day following the Last Permissible Physical Settlement Date;
